Annual Irish production increased by 3.5% in year to October 2009; Turnover dipped 21.2% on price falls

On an annual basis production for Irish Manufacturing Industries for October 2009 was 3.5% higher than in October 2008, while turnover was down 21.2% on price falls, in particular the impact of the rise of the euro against sterling.
